The Commonwealth of Virginia FHA Home Financing Requirements & Eligibility
Navigating the VA housing market can be simpler than you think, particularly when exploring Federal Housing Administration (FHA) loan options. So as to be approved for an FHA home purchase in Virginia, applicants generally need to demonstrate a stable earnings, a credit history that isn’t excessively burdened with difficult marks, and the ability to process the required initial investment. Typically, this initial investment is 3.5% of the home's purchase value, which is considerably less than many conventional financing programs. Furthermore, borrowers need to possess proper identification and meet debt-to-financial ratio standards, which can vary depending on the specific lender and the complete risk assessment. It's also critical to understand the state’s specific property guidelines for FHA valuation, ensuring the property meets minimum safety standards.

VA FHA Mortgage Restrictions & Rules
Navigating VA's property market can be complex, and understanding the Federal Housing Administration home financing caps and standards is crucial for potential homeowners. FHA's programs are designed to make buying a home more affordable, particularly for those with smaller down payments. Currently, the state has varying financing caps based on the county. These limits are typically tied to average property costs within the particular region. For example, several regions within Central the state function at the highest FHA home limit, which can fluctuate annually. Besides, Federal Housing Administration requires that applicants meet particular credit qualifications, including documentation of earnings and an satisfactory credit history.
